Age of Industry Section 1:Living from the Land - During the late 1700's and early 1800's, great changes took place in the lives and work of people in several parts of the Western world. - These changes resulted from the development of industrialization. The term Industrial Revolution refers both to the changes that occurred and to the period itself. - The Industrial Revolution began in Britain (a country now known as the United Kingdom) during …
